CONTROLLING A TWO-DIMENSIONAL MIRROR GIMBAL FOR PURPOSES OF IRIS SCANNING

An iris scanning device includes a first camera that captures an image of a face of a user and a second camera that captures an image of an eye of the user subsequent to the image of the face being captured. The iris scanning device includes a gimbal having a mirror mounted thereon and a facial feature detector that identifies facial features of the user based upon the image of the face. The iris scanning device further includes control circuitry that adjusts an orientation of the gimbal based upon the facial features, where the image of the eye is captured upon the orientation of the gimbal being adjusted, and where the mirror mounted on the gimbal is oriented to cause the image of the eye to be captured. An iris of the eye of the user may be located in a central region of the image of the eye.

Removable lens accessories for image capture devices

An image capture device is described that includes a body; a mounting structure that is connected to the body; an integrated sensor-lens assembly (ISLA) that defines an optical axis and extends through the body and the mounting structure; and an accessory that is releasably connectable to the mounting structure via rotation through a range of motion less than approximately 90 degrees. The mounting structure and the accessory include corresponding angled bearing surfaces that are configured for engagement such that rotation of the accessory relative to the mounting structure creates a bearing effect that displaces the accessory along the optical axis to thereby reduce any axial force required during connection and disconnection of the accessory.

RING FLASH LIGHT DIFFUSION DEVICE
20220325868 · 2022-10-13 ·

A ring flash light diffusion device includes a first converter ring configured to connect to a camera lens and a diffuser adapter. The diffuser adapter can be connected to a first end of the first converter ring. It also includes a flash ring connected to the diffuser adapter at a position along the length of the diffuser adapter and a ring flash connected to the flash ring. It further includes a light diffuser connected to the diffuser adapter such that light emitted from the ring flash passes through the light diffuser.

Image capturing apparatus and accessories

An image capturing apparatus on which an accessory including a first mount is mountable includes a second mount. The second mount is configured to allow bayonet coupling to the first mount of the accessory. The second mount includes a plurality of terminals disposed in a circumferential direction, and a terminal holder configured to hold the plurality of terminals. Each of the plurality of terminals is electrically connectable to a terminal of the accessory. The terminal holder has a height level difference in a center-axis direction of the second mount. The plurality of terminals include a first terminal configured to be used to detect mounting of the accessory on the image capturing apparatus. The first terminal is disposed further in a mount direction of the accessory than the other terminals among the plurality of terminals on a first stage of the terminal holder.

Attachment system for coupling a mobile computing device to optics
11624969 · 2023-04-11 ·

Provided is an attachment system for coupling a mobile computing device to an optic device. The optic device may be, but is not limited to a scope, binoculars or the like. The attachment system operates with attachment devices and mounting device with apertures that provide a means to couple a mobile computing device to the optic device in such a way that the attachment system provides a line-of-sight between a camera of the mobile computing device with the lens of the optic device. This allows the camera of the mobile computing device to capture images and video using the high power zoom functionality of the optic device and the convenience of the mobile computing device.

Front converter optical assembly for camera
11650487 · 2023-05-16 ·

An apparatus includes multiple optical elements arranged along an optical path between an entrance aperture and an exit aperture, configured to image an object at infinity to an image at infinity and defining an exit pupil for light at the exit aperture, the image have a magnification, M, in a range from 7× to 15×. The optical elements include four non-planar mirrors. The apparatus also includes a connector configured to attach the apparatus to a mobile device having a camera with the exit pupil of the plurality of optical elements aligned with an entrance pupil of the camera of the mobile device.
